Destiny Etiko (born 12 August 1989) is a Nigerian actress.

Etiko in an interview affirmed that she had been a victim of sexual harassment against women by male movie producers who are by far the majority as pertains movie productions in Nigeria. In 2019, Etiko gifted her mum an apartment and praised her for supporting her decision to become an actress. Her father, on the other hand, had vehemently opposed her decision to become an actress at the initial time. In May 2020, she lost her father. Etiko created a non-profit organization called the Destiny Etiko Foundation, intended to improve the conditions of people living in poverty. She has an adopted Daughter named Chinenye Eucharia.
